Default AEV front bumper with AEV skid plate & SwayLoc

Anyone done this? I am finding it hard to get a clear answer on if there are any clearance issues. 2.5 inch lift.

AEV say maybe on the skid plate

ORO say maybe at full droop only

Quadratech say no problem
